How does Yoni Mudra work?

Steps of Yoni Mudra: Bring the palms of your hands together in the Namaste posture, and point the thumbs up. Meanwhile, the two index fingers and the two thumbs form a closed ring. Now, press the pointed thumbs on your navel. While you hold this position, breathe slowly and deeply.

Which mudra is best for peace of mind?

Dhyana mudra Sit with your hands palms facing up. Place the back of the right hand on top of the left palm and touch the tips of the thumbs together to create a circle. The right hand placed on top is a sign of enlightenment, tranquility and inner peace. The Buddha is often depicted using this gesture.

How is Yoni mudra related to the uterus?

The Yoni mudra can be described as a gesture that allows a person to get detached from the chaos of the outer existing world. Yoni means uterus or womb and this gesture is named the Yoni Mudra, because the person who practices it regularly has no external contact with the world, pretty much like a baby in the uterus.
